- 博客(11)
- 资源 (8)
- 收藏
- 关注
原创 触摸事件
TouchEvent代表一个事件(接触或者触摸状态改变时触发的一个事件),一个或者多个接触点的接触、移动、移除以及增加接触点等都会触发这样一个事件。其构造函数TouchEvent()用于产生一个TouchEvent对象。这个接口继承于UIEvent和Event,当然也继承了它们的属性。有几种类型的触摸事件用来表示触摸相关的改变已经发生,你可以通过TouchEvent.type来判断具体是发生什么改变。
2016-03-15 00:57:51 2884
原创 “服务器推”之websocket实现之简单聊天室
最近在学习Server-push的一些技术,websocket当然也要简单学习一下。一个简单的websocket实现聊天室的例子:websocket在tomcat中只有tomcat7支持,tomcat7以下的是没实现这个功能,而tomcat7以上的则是将其remove了,tomcat团队只是对version6中的一个bug作修复,不再继续开发,原因是被JSR356 websocket1.1
2015-07-08 16:40:17 5408 1
原创 “服务器推”之Iframe配合comet实现
首先,通过tomcat的comet来实现服务器推的技术要在tomcat的Server.xml文件中修改一下设置:将普通情况的改为:其次,服务器端使用实现了org.apache.catalina.comet.CometProcessor接口的HTTPservlet来处理,在其中实现这个接口的event方法,要加入tomcat的catalina.jar这个包(有可能待版本号
2015-07-06 11:47:30 2403 2
原创 Linux下重启tomcat
最近在学习shell编程,以完成一些基础操作,任务驱动学习,这样适用,故边学边试着用一下,来写一个tomcat重启shell脚本,其实其他的没有restart都差不多吧。一、在自己的用户的一个目录下新建两个.sh文件tomcat_shutdown.sh:#!/bin/sh`/home/wz/dev/server/tomcat/apache-tomcat-6.0.41/b
2015-06-12 00:09:09 6013
原创 用cronolog为tomcat做日志分割之问题解决版
XXX 不在 sudoers 文件中。此事将被报告。百度一番,需要修改/etc/sudoers文件,将要赋权的用户添加到里面:如下三行(如果都不存在就添加进去,第一行是注释,但是第二行不是哦)## Allow members of group sudo to execute any command # %sudo ALL=(ALL) ALL xx AL
2015-06-10 11:14:46 4759
原创 用cronolog为tomcat做日志分割
做这样的日志分割,前提是你在项目文件中是用log4j来打印日志的,当然必需要有相应的jar包1、下载(cronolog-1.6.2.zip我下的是这个,只是压缩方式不一样,在Linux下一样的用)用secureCRT传到自己的目录下。2、解压缩 #unzip cronolog-1.6.2.zip3、进入cronolog安装文件所在目录 # cd
2015-06-09 17:21:01 2521
原创 quartz储存方式之JDBC JobStoreTX
这篇单单记录一下个人配置使用quartz的JDBC JobStoreTX的过程以及其中遇到的问题,这里的quartz是version2.2.1,数据库使用的mysql。JDBCJobStore储存是速度比较慢的,但是也不至于很坏,通过JDBCJobStore储存于数据库的方式适用于Oracle,PostgreSQL, MySQL, MS SQLServer, HSQLDB, DB2等数据库
2015-06-04 11:27:31 31402 11
原创 tomcat结合Java定时任务工具实现web中的定时任务
在Java实现简单定时任务一篇记录中描述的是Java的几种定时任务的方式,那是最基本的,仅仅是main方法里测试,用途也受限。这里研究一下在web中怎么实现这些个定时任务,在这儿作个备忘:在上一篇里我们都是在Java执行的主线程中以main方法的方式来手动启动和结束这些定时任务,这在web中怎么实现呢?首先,我们先找到这个定时任务启动和结束的触发事件;然后,这个事件放生时就启动我们
2015-05-24 00:23:06 11856
原创 Java实现简单定时任务
了解了一下Java实现简单定时任务的三种方式,分别做了个例子。自己写篇以记录、备忘。注释都清楚了,不另外解释。方式一:package test.timertask;/** * 使用Thread.sleep的方式来实现 * 这种方式完全是自己实现的,该控制的地方控制,怎么写都可以 * @author wz */public class MyTimerTask { pu
2015-05-23 16:58:24 5897 4
原创 javascript里函数提升与逻辑运算
f = function() { return true; }; g = function() { return false; }; (function aa() { if (g() && [] == ![]) { f = function f() { return false; }; function g() { return true;
2015-05-21 18:22:32 841
转载 Eclipse自动生成UML图--Green UML
Green UML最靠谱了。可以从已有的代码自动生成UML图。安装方法:1.从http://green.sourceforge.net/builds.html查找对应自己Eclipse的GEF版本和Green UML版本2.从http://www.eclipse.org/gef/downloads.php下载对应版本的GEF,下载后直接解
2014-09-12 10:20:27 2776
quartz-2.2.1-distribution.tar.gz
2017-03-13
WebSocket 1.1 API - Apache Tomcat 7.0.CHM
2015-07-08
weblogic.jdbc.vendor.oracle.OracleThinBlob
2015-06-04
JSP 标准标记库(JSP Standard Tag Library,JSTL)
2011-03-02
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人